Even though English is a difficult subject for young language learners to understand, I try to provide material that is easy for students to understand. for example,  learn the basic English alphabet, sing a song in English, recognizing English numbers, and playing games in English, in order to create a happy and cheerful atmosphere.


    Each student certainly has a different character. The difference in the character of each student is something that challenges me to get the personality of each student. However, the toughest challenge is meeting students who have a shy, insecure, quiet personality and also students who like to make noise in class.
Therefore, we need to understand the students. so that we know how to find solutions to make students interested in learning.
There are several ways to overcome the challenges, so that they are interested to learn English language:
1. Understanding the character of students.
2. Create a cool atmosphere.
3. Give the easy material, like learn English alphabet or recognizing English numbers.
4. Play game in learning English.
5. Give students rewards.
6. Be patient.
7. Always smile when communicating with students.
8. And the most important is teaching students with great compassion.
